For a fast service«individual» pizza place they have a pretty good concept. You can select your crust white or whole wheat and either go with one of the listed configurations or pick and choose your sauce and toppings. Loved the half salad — beautiful red tipped greens with bits of tomato, onions, shaved parm and freshly roasted sunflower seeds. The whole grain mustard dressing was an awesome change from what is available in most places but in the end the salad was a bit overdressed, so you may want to ask for your dressing on the side to save yourself that headache. The pizza arrives quickly(90 seconds in the oven) and the crust is bubbly and nicely charred. They don’t go crazy on the cheese which I like because you get to taste everything else on the pizza. I only had a one item pizza but would watch to see if in the future other pizzas with multiple toppings get more cheese, and if needed I would ask to have a half cheese pizza. Décor is nice, the patio was full when we stopped in but a window seat worked well on this sunny day. Service was professional and friendly. As to my opening comment, be aware that their«individual» pizza is a ten inch pizza, which for most health minded people will work out to at least two meals, but if you are one of those who don’t mind if your waist size is nearing the big 50 you might want to order two.

We went to Pi for lunch today and were so pleased! Wood-fired personal(I think 10″ each) pizzas. And I believe they start at around $ 5.95 each(don’t hold me to that, but I think thats what I recall seeing on the menu) There are pizzas you can order(ones they’ve designed) as well as a build-your-own option, but they are all made fresh. The dough is fresh — not frozen. We watched an employee stretch balls of dough into our crust, spread the tomato sauce onto them, then add our toppings. You could see her build our pizzas, which ensures freshness… and is also kind of cool to watch. According to the guy who took our order each pizza takes roughly 90 seconds in the oven to cook. We started with the jalapeño cheese bread which was WAY too hot for me… so my husband had plenty for himself. Actual jalenepos in bread filled with cheese. Not my cup of tea, but he thought it was awesome. My pizza I’ll call basic and classic. Half cheese, half pepperoni. Huge pepperonis. Really delicious crust. My husband was(and typically is) more adventurous. He had cremini mushrooms and beef. It looked really good and he said that it WAS really good. Oh, the ranch dressing is 50 cents for a side order — totally worth the extra cost. Really good! Not sure how much longer we’ll be in the Rochester area, but we may not go anywhere else for pizza. I’m not sure if any other places do wood-fired pizzas here. Very good!
